Patents by Inventor Craig Tomita

Craig Tomita has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20070279780
    Abstract: A method for selecting a write current for a disk drive including writing a test track on a magnetic media at one of a plurality of write current levels, and writing signals to the magnetic media at positions adjacent to the test track at substantially the same write current level as used on the test track. The method also includes reading the signals from the magnetic media at positions adjacent to the test track, and monitoring a parameter associated with the signals read from the adjacent test track, and selecting one of the write current levels based on the monitored parameter.
    Type: Application
    Filed: May 31, 2006
    Publication date: December 6, 2007
    Inventor: Craig Tomita
  • Publication number: 20070279788
    Abstract: A method of determining defects on a media of an information storage device includes reading information representing data from a magnetized portion of the media, processing the read signal with discrete time signal processing, and detecting a phase shift in the read signal over a selected threshold. The method also includes sending an indication of a defect in the media in response to detecting the phase shift over the selected threshold, determining the location of the media of the defect, and storing the location of the defect in memory.
    Type: Application
    Filed: May 31, 2006
    Publication date: December 6, 2007
    Inventors: James W. Andersen, Craig Tomita
  • Publication number: 20070279781
    Abstract: A method for estimating a rate of errors written to a magnetic media includes writing a selected number of signals representing information to a track on the magnetic media, and adjusting a programmable portion of an error correction code module for correcting a selected number of errors in a portion of data to a level where the track having the selected number of signals can be read and corrected. The method also includes correlating the level of the programmable portion of the error correction code module to the number of errors in the selected number of signals written to the track.
    Type: Application
    Filed: May 31, 2006
    Publication date: December 6, 2007
    Inventor: Craig Tomita